Beyond fictional dramas, the keyword "phim cap vinh" often intersects with real-life high-profile relationships that feel like movie scripts. The most famous example is the legendary "Cặp Vinh - Tiên" (footballer Lê Công Vinh and singer Thủy Tiên).

Public Romance: Their relationship has been chronicled by the media as a real-life fairy tale, featuring grand gestures like surprise birthday parties in foreign countries and navigating public "storms" (sóng gió) together.

Cultural Impact: This real-life couple sets a benchmark for the "romantic storyline" that fans look for in fictional media—loyalty, overcoming public scrutiny, and building a family (their daughter, Bánh Gạo). Cultural Significance of Romance in Vietnamese Cinema

Romantic storylines in Vietnamese media, whether in long-running dramas (some spanning up to 87 episodes) or celebrity news, emphasize traditional values like loyalty (thủy chung) and the triumph of love over greed. Whether it is the fictional Vinh Hiển or the real Công Vinh, the "Cặp Vinh" keyword represents a search for aspirational love stories that balance modern passion with traditional perseverance.

When global audiences think of Vietnamese cinema or television dramas, the first images that come to mind might be the lush landscapes of The Scent of Green Papaya or the gritty war epics. However, in the bustling landscape of modern Vietnamese entertainment, a specific genre has captured the hearts of millions: the phim cảnh vệ (bodyguard film or series).

While the genre promises high-octane action, slow-motion walks, and impeccably tailored black suits, the secret ingredient that keeps viewers hitting "next episode" is rarely the choreography of the fistfights. It is the relationship dynamics and romantic storylines.

In phim cảnh vệ, love is not a distraction from duty; it is the ultimate wildcard. It is the vulnerability inside the bulletproof vest. This article dives deep into the anatomy of these relationships, exploring why the romance in Vietnamese bodyguard dramas is more addictive than the action itself.

Once Upon a Love Story (Vietnamese: Ngày xưa có một chuyện tình) is a poignant exploration of friendship and the complexities of romance, based on the celebrated novel by Nguyen Nhat Anh. The film's narrative centers on the deeply intertwined lives of three main characters—Vinh, Mien, and Phuc—tracing their journey from shared childhood innocence to the messy realities of adulthood. Core Relationship Dynamics

The heartbeat of the film lies in the classic childhood-friends-to-lovers trope, though it is far from straightforward. The story examines how early bonds are tested by evolving emotions and life's unpredictable challenges.

Vinh, Mien, and Phuc: The central trio shares a history rooted in a rural Vietnamese village in the late 1980s. Their relationship is characterized by a "springtime love" that feels pure yet fragile as they navigate the boundaries between platonic friendship and romantic yearning.

The Romantic Conflict: As they grow, the simple companionship of their youth evolves into a more complex emotional landscape. Characters face inner doubts and the "subtle challenges" that arise when instinctual attraction collides with the reason and loyalty owed to long-term friends. Key Themes in the Storylines

Nostalgia and Growth: Similar to other Vietnamese rural dramas like Yellow Flowers on the Green Grass, the film uses the backdrop of a poor village to emphasize the emotional weight of small, shared moments.

Love vs. Loyalty: Much of the tension stems from how the characters handle their feelings without destroying their foundational bond. The narrative portrays the "tender bond" of early emotions and the struggle to protect that purity against the temptations and pressures of growing up.
